Portál AbcLinuxu, 26. dubna 2024 22:39


Dotaz: funguje pouze MIDI IN, nikoliv MIDI OUT

26.4.2005 23:51 seventhatom
funguje pouze MIDI IN, nikoliv MIDI OUT
Přečteno: 208×
Odpovědět | Admin
Nevite nekdo, cim by to mohlo byt, ze vidim pouze MIDI IN port na sve zvukovce? Mam kartu Turtle Beach Fiji, iniciuji ji po startu prikazy modprobe v etc/rc.d/rc.local. Nemusi nekde byt nadefinovan MIDI OUT port v nejakym konfiguraku? Kartu provozuji v NonPnP modu, tzn. sama se nenakonfigurovala po startu. Predem moc diky za rady.
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

27.4.2005 10:43 Ctirad Feřtr | skóre: 43 | Praha
Rozbalit Rozbalit vše Re: funguje pouze MIDI IN, nikoliv MIDI OUT
Odpovědět | | Sbalit | Link | Blokovat | Admin
Co píše "amidi -l" ?
27.4.2005 23:48 seventhatom
Rozbalit Rozbalit vše Re: funguje pouze MIDI IN, nikoliv MIDI OUT
pise to toto:

[root@Vigor10 etc]# amidi -l Device Name hw:0,0 MSND MIDI

nebo aconnect -i

[root@Vigor10 etc]# aconnect -i client 0: 'System' [type=kernel] 0 'Timer ' 1 'Announce ' client 64: 'MSND MIDI' [type=kernel] 0 'MSND MIDI
27.4.2005 23:52 seventhatom
Rozbalit Rozbalit vše Re: funguje pouze MIDI IN, nikoliv MIDI OUT
pokud dam aconnect -o (writable output ports) nevypise nic, pokud aconnect -i, pak to same jako -l.
28.4.2005 00:00 seventhatom
Rozbalit Rozbalit vše Re: funguje pouze MIDI IN, nikoliv MIDI OUT
pokud nenahraji modul snd-seq-oss a pokusim se vypsat out porty pise chybu

[seventhatom@Vigor10 ~]$ aconnect -o ALSA lib seq_hw.c:446:(snd_seq_hw_open) open /dev/snd/seq failed: No such file or directory can't open sequencer
25.8.2007 21:48 Pavel Kysilka
Rozbalit Rozbalit vše Re: funguje pouze MIDI IN, nikoliv MIDI OUT
Odpovědět | | Sbalit | Link | Blokovat | Admin
zdravim,

tak se mi povedlo vykoumat s primerenou mirou pravdepodobnosti, proc to nefunguje a funguje, jak funguje.

MultiSound karty maji nekolik MIDI-IN a MIDI-OUT vstupu. Nicmene alsa driver nema prepinani techto vstupu naimplmentovano.

Cilize je treba naimplementovat toto:

- pri kazdem spusteni midi instance prepnout adekvatni MIDI vstup a vystup

- dodelat prepinac v mixeru na MIDI-In a MIDI-Out

- prepinac v mixeru by mel fungovat podle typu hardware - Zde je nekolik typu MSND Classic, Pinnacle Karty, Rio modul.

Vice asi napovi MSDN SDK kit i s priklady. Cilize muzes zkusit pridat pred spustenim midi streamu zdroj vstupu a vystupu. SetMidiIn() a SetMidiOut() funkce v SDK kit-u. Ja se k tomu nejak dostanu snad do konce zari. Ted mam i cas.

Co chybi v driveru

- vyse jmenovany prepinac.

- driver netestovan na Classic seriich karet - na to se nejak mrknu

- spravne pojmenovat zarizeni(pcm, mixer, midi) - Pinnacle a Turtle Beach karty - s tim, ze karty Pinnacle jdou detekovat

- PNP detekce Pinnacle karet - ta nechodi a neni ani implementovana. Zde by se mi hodilo poslat cely adresar s konkretnim pnp zazirenim - adresar /sys/ a nejaka asi pnp1 slozka. Toto se da obslehnout treba z isa-wawefront driveru.

- nevim, jak dobre bude slapat pridavna karta Rio a zda pojede tento zdroj sam. I kdyz to asi mozna bude bezet na driveru od wawefront-u.

Nejak se na to mrknu casem. Zadadni problem u me je ted maly disk a preinstalace na vetsi a moznost rychleji kompilovat na silnejsi masine pres nfs.

bye gf

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.